Hydropower generation across California and the American West has declined in this extremely dry year, meaning that electricity providers will lean more heavily on natural gas, solar, and wind power. President Biden’s goal is to cut the country’s greenhouse gas emissions in half by 2030, and to reach net zero emissions by 2050.

Dutch Elections: Energy and Climate Considerations

Energy and Climate Law

Another topic is carbon capture and storage (CCS), which could take place at the large gas- and coal-fired powerplants as well as at heavy industry sites such as the oil refineries near Rotterdam and the steel plant at IJmuiden. Carbon Dioxide could be stored offshore in depleted gas fields in the North Sea.
